Abstract

The development of Information Communication and Technology (ICT) has an impact on the education. But teacher still use conventional methods. Therefore, this research aims to develop educational game media using the Construct 2 to improve the literacy numeracy skills of third grade elementary school students that are valid, practical, and effective. This development research refers to the ADDIE. The results of the development were applied to class III students at SD Negeri Janti for the 2022/2023 academic year. The development product is the Monster Math Game. The research instruments are validation sheets, questionnaires, and literacy numeration questions. The validity test was obtained from 3 experts, namely Curriculum Expert, Material Expert, and Media Expert. Results form Curriculum Expert at 87.5%, Material Expert at 86.4%, and Media Expert at 89.3%. So, it can be concluded that the Monster Math Game is very feasible to use to improve the literacy numeracy skills of Class III Elementary School. The results of the practicality test from educators were 89.3% and the practicality tests from students were 94.15%. From these results, it can be concluded that the Monster Math Game is very practical to use. The results of the effectiveness test through the t-test obtained the results of the sig value. (2-tailed) of 0.000 which means the sig. (2-tailed) < 0.05, so there is a significant difference between the results of the pre-test and post-test, it’s means that the Monster Math Game product is effective in improving the literacy numeracy skills of class III elementary school.
